Budgets are more than just numbers, they are about setting priorities. With skyrocketing budget deficits, Congress must decide where its priorities lie — what will be funded and what will be cut. The Green Scissors Campaign, and the report that follows, offers a few practical solutions to policymakers that will assist in reducing the federal deficit while simultaneously protecting the environment. These are win-win solutions that benefit taxpayers and the environment; the public and politicians; and provide an invaluable opportunity for decisionmakers to navigate the challenging fiscal and environmental decisions that lie ahead.
